摘要: 研究了刺槐克隆种群的种群结构和生长动态.结果表明,刺槐克隆种群中幼年分株数量较多,死亡率较高;成年个体数量较少,死亡率较低,而且相对稳定,种群数量结构成金字塔型;无性系产生分株的时间较晚,分株的数量正处于上升阶段.无性系中刺槐基株的基径、高度、冠幅远远大于分株.刺槐分株在幼年时期高生长和冠幅的生长均较快,当生长到一定的年龄逐渐缓慢下来.克隆分株的生长、数量动态主要受克隆整合的内部调节机制和外部环境中灌木层、草本层竞争的影响.

Abstract: The population structure and dynamics of Robinia pseudoacacia clones are studied.The result indicates that the clone population has relative stable and pyramidal number structure,made up of abundant infancy daughter ramets with high death rate,and few adult daughter ramets with low death rate.Clones produce daughter ramets at high age stage and the number of daughter ramets is increasing.The diameter at ground height (DGH),height and canopy width of genet are significantly larger than those of daughter ramets.The growth of height and canopy width is accelerated at infancy stage,but relatively stable at adult stage.The growth and dynamics of daughter ramets are affected by genet though clonal integration,and competition from shrubs and herbage of surroundings.
